1996 GSX-R750 SRAD Suzuki

1996 GSX-R750 SRAD   Suzuki heavily revamped this model with a host of features – many of which were derived from the firm’s factory race bikes.

Starting with the frame, the engineers in Hamamatsu abandoned the aluminum double-cradle chassis for the first time since the introduction of the Gixxer, bestowing the 1996 version with a new twin-spar structure based on the RGV GP racer of the day. The new frame was paired with updated fully-adjustable suspension comprised of 43mm inverted Showa forks up front and a monoshock out back. Slowing the 750 was a set of six-piston Tokico calipers chomping down on 320mm discs.

The new engine featured a side cam chain, SCEM (Silicon Carbide Electro-Plate) cylinder, and the model’s namesake SRAD (Suzuki Ram Air Direct) induction system. The most compact and lightweight inline-four in its class, the redesigned engine was able to shirk a good deal of weight via the use of new magnesium cylinder head, starter motor, and clutch covers. On top of the new engine and frame, the ’96 GSX-R also got all-new wind-tunnel-developed bodywork inspired by Kevin Schwantz’s RG500 GP mount. While its improved 130.2hp output, revised chassis, and sleek new appearance were definitely of note, the biggest highlight of the updated model was undoubtedly its weight; a svelte 453 lbs fully fueled and ready-to-go. That not only made it 50 lbs lighter than the outgoing model but also placed it in the same ballpark as the 600 class while boasting more peak power than Honda’s CBR900RR.

2000 Honda VTR1000 SP1 RC51

2000 Honda VTR1000 SP1 RC51 with 39,760km and in very good condition with no cracked or broken fairings, original mufflers and still has its rear tail which was a common mod.

At the end of 1999, Honda unveiled this big twin. Built in frustration, to demonstrate just what Honda could do if it wanted to, the RC51 VTR1000 SP-1 was a state-of-the-art racing motorcycle that wore its Honda Racing Corporation stickers with pride. The bike was all-new, owing nothing to the previous VTR1000 Firestorm. Like its HRC predecessors, it used expensive-but-necessary luxuries like gear-driven camshafts. It also had the same careful attention to detail that had made the RC30/45 so special. The SP-1 made more power than the Ducati, had more modern design, but carried a price tag only a little above that of a FireBlade. Not only were Honda looking to humiliate Ducati on the track, but in the showroom too.

The SP-1 wasn’t dainty or pretty like a Ducati. It was purposeful and well-hard. The Ducati might have weighed five kg less but Honda’s insistence that the SP-1 be built as well as its other top-spec machines meant that the SP-1’s exhausts were bullet proof.

1984 Honda NS250R

1984 Honda NS250R with only 7,666 km on the clock, this bike is a true time capsule and looks to be all original paint Rothmans edition,

The R model was developed using the latest sophisticated technologies gained from the 1983 MotoGP world Champion racer "Honda NS500".the NS250R is equipped with an aluminum frame and a full fairing.

The engine is a lightweight, slim and compact designed V-twin 90 degree angle to help reduce vibration. The inner walls of the cylinders use the NS cylinder coating technology which is nickel silicon carbide particles dispersed in the cylinder body wall surface. Using this technology and light weight aluminum pistons, wear resistance and seizures are greatly reduced.

The R model adopts the NS Comstar wheels front and rear. In addition to handle the high-performance load, the R model is fitted with a sport style full fairing.

1985 Honda VF1000R

1985 Honda VF1000R with a genuine 18,922km from new, we just did a cosmetic restoration which included a show quality repaint of the fairings and tail section but the tank is still original paint, has brand new tyres front and rear, new battery, carbs were pulled down and thoroughly cleaned.
Almost impossible to find with all the original parts and milage this low they are a true collectors bike.
Developed with the technology to win races, the VF1000R was a massive technological wonder when it was released in Europe; especially when compared to the rather bland “F” model.
Four cylinders arranged in a 90 degree vee formation, double overhead cams spun by gears (oh the glorious sound!) working four valves per cylinder. The frame was of the perimeter variety to cradle the motor, but tech extended to both ends of this machine: Honda’s Pro-Link rising-rate rear suspension (a massive upgrade over twin shock setups) and up front the Torque Reactive Anti-Dive Control (TRAC) anti-dive front fork with nifty quick change axle (a nod to the endurance heritage). With a 16″ front wheel – just like the GP racers – and bodywork and dual headlamp evoking Honda’s endurance racers from Europe, the VF1000R was everything you could want in a race replica and much, much more. Especially in terms of weight. The “R” model looked the look, but tipped in at a very porky mid-500 pound range wet. It also came with a significant increase in price over the “F” model. But you can’t really argue with the look.

1986 Kawasaki GPZ1000RX

1986 Kawasaki GPZ1000RX with a genuine 22,304 miles and in very original dead stock condition.

Evolved from the 900 cc model, the GPZ1000RX displaced 997 cc’s and laid down 125 hp. Cycle World tested it as the fastest bike they had ever pointed their radar gun at, going by at 159 mph. The strength of the engine was matched by the new perimeter frame and seriously built steering head holding 40mm forks and swingarm supported by Kawasaki’s Uni-Track monoshock. Brakes were dual 280mm front discs and 260mm rear. Weighing in the light-heavyweight area of a little over 500 lbs., handling is helped by 16-inch wheels.

1985 Suzuki GSXR750F

1985 Suzuki GSXR750F with a low genuine 10,360 km from new, this first year Gixxer had the flat side Mikuni carbs and was an instant sucess on the race track and the street.

The new Suzuki Slabside proved it's worth in its initial race outings and it performance could not be questioned. Here are just a few examples:

1985 – One of the first outings for the new model was to the famous Suzuki 8 hours endurance race, where the team placed 3rd.

1985 – The Gixxer broke multiple records in a Cycle World hosted 24 hour endurance test.

1985 – MCN British Superstock Championship won 9/11 races.

1985 – Mick Grant rode a standard version to victory in the Isle of Man TT production class.

1983 Suzuki NX85 Turbo

Ultra rare 1983 Suzuki XN85 Turbo with a low 13,240 miles, very original bike that will clean up nicely.  The real trick with this XN85 was not so much the engine, but the chassis. The main frame was a round-tube double-cradle affair, with a triangulated backbone running to the steering head. Up front was a 37mm Kayaba fork, with anti-dive and air-adjustability, providing 5.5 inches of travel. Rake was a conservative 27 degrees, with trail of 3.9 inches. The fork connected to a 16-inch front wheel – which surprised many. Sixteen inches?! That was racing stuff. But even with a pretty lengthy 58.7 inches between axles, the bike handled extremely well. Probably helped along by the Full-Floater rear suspension, using an aluminum swingarm with caged needle bearings, the single Kayaba shock having remote hydraulic preload adjustment. And 4.1 inches of travel.

There were not many Turbo bikes made back in the 80s and this was one of the better ones.
